Good evening,

Currently weathering my 37401 and about to fit the 3 piece snow ploughs. Has anyone fitted the two outer blades around the tension lock coupling? If so, how was this done please?

Keep the ploughs as supplied, cut the tails off and a slot in the centre plough and fit the supplied coupling through it, works with Kadee's also. For a much better result, fit a set of Heljan 47 ploughs behind the bufferbeam, looks much better on curves, as the plough does not then follow the bogie movement and over hang the track.
